Direct Answer

Consumer revenue is driven by tax preparation; Small Business and Self-Employed revenue includes QuickBooks subscriptions, payroll, payments, and related services; Credit Karma connects consumers with financial products; Mailchimp adds marketing automation. Transaction and payments revenue can scale with customer activity rather than seats alone.

Revenue Engines

QuickBooks and related small-business services, TurboTax, Credit Karma, and Mailchimp are the major engines. Payments and assisted services can increase revenue per customer but carry different margins from pure software subscriptions.

Economic Engine

Software subscriptions and digital tax preparation can have strong margins, while assisted services, payments, and marketing products introduce different costs. Tax season creates pronounced seasonality. Economics improve when customers adopt multiple modules and use the platform for more financial activity.

Defensibility

The moat includes brand trust, tax-domain expertise, integrations with financial institutions, accountant ecosystems, small-business data, switching costs in bookkeeping and payroll, and a large installed base of financial workflows.
